Canterbury to defend Ranfurly Shield against North Otago

From Midday Report, 12:45 pm on 28 August 2020

Canterbury will defend the Ranfurly Shield against North Otago in Christchurch today.

The game will be played with no crowd at Rugby Park. North Otago have challenged Canterbury for the Shield on four previous occasions and the closest they got was a 14-nil loss in 1971.

It is an extra special game for North Otago who won't be able to defend their Meads Cup title this year after the Heartland Championships was cancelled because of Covid-19.

Coach Jason Forrest told RNZ sports reporter, Barry Guy, that it's been a tough year for their players.
